使用Git提交到github.com,但是很多时候基本上每次都要输入密码
在根目录下架了.gitignore,里面加入忽略目录的名字,但是还是无法忽略
#.gitignore /www/Application/Runtime*
我已经在github中添加了ssh 密匙了,也在本地有一个SSH密匙,但是还是必须输入密码。
핵심은 SSH 채널을 사용하지 않는 https를 사용한다는 점이므로 키는 쓸모가 없습니다. https용 비밀번호를 저장하려면 http://git.oschina.net/oschina/git-를 참조하세요. osc/issues/2586, ssh+key를 제출할 때 비밀번호가 필요하지 않고 원격 지점에서 SSH 프로토콜을 사용해야 하는 경우 git@github.com:xx/xx.git
git@github.com:xx/xx.git
푸시할 때 비밀번호를 입력하는 것이 일반적입니다. 이 단계를 생략하려면 몇 가지 조치를 취할 수 있습니다.
.gitignore 문제 정보:
프로젝트 및 디렉터리의 www/Application/에서 Runtime으로 시작하는 모든 파일을 무시하려면 www 앞의 /를 제거하면 됩니다. /는 루트 디렉터리를 나타냅니다.
Ssh를 사용하여 연결
.gitignore의 경로는 저장소 자체에 상대적입니다.
프로토콜을 변경하고 git+ssh를 사용하여 http://www.ctrlqun.com/linux_... 기사에 따라 구성했습니다. 모든 것이 정상입니다. 비밀번호를 다시 입력할 필요가 없습니다
핵심은 SSH 채널을 사용하지 않는 https를 사용한다는 점이므로 키는 쓸모가 없습니다. https용 비밀번호를 저장하려면 http://git.oschina.net/oschina/git-를 참조하세요. osc/issues/2586, ssh+key를 제출할 때 비밀번호가 필요하지 않고 원격 지점에서 SSH 프로토콜을 사용해야 하는 경우
git@github.com:xx/xx.git
푸시할 때 비밀번호를 입력하는 것이 일반적입니다. 이 단계를 생략하려면 몇 가지 조치를 취할 수 있습니다.
.gitignore 문제 정보:
프로젝트 및 디렉터리의 www/Application/에서 Runtime으로 시작하는 모든 파일을 무시하려면 www 앞의 /를 제거하면 됩니다. /는 루트 디렉터리를 나타냅니다.
Ssh를 사용하여 연결
.gitignore의 경로는 저장소 자체에 상대적입니다.
프로토콜을 변경하고 git+ssh를 사용하여 http://www.ctrlqun.com/linux_... 기사에 따라 구성했습니다. 모든 것이 정상입니다. 비밀번호를 다시 입력할 필요가 없습니다